Why Old Pipe Leaks Can't Wait
Leaks from old plumbing systems escalate rapidly. Galvanised steel pipes, common in pre-1970s builds, corrode from the inside out. A small drip today can be a catastrophic rupture tomorrow, flooding walls and floors. Lead pipes, aside from health concerns, become brittle and can fracture without much warning. Even copper, while durable, suffers from pitting corrosion over decades, leading to sudden, pin-sized leaks that spray water under pressure. The moment you suspect a leak—a drop in pressure, a discoloured patch, a musty smell—you're already on the clock. Immediate investigation is critical to contain damage.

Can you detect leaks in old pipes without causing major damage to my walls or floors?
Yes. Our engineers use non-invasive acoustic and thermal imaging technology specifically suited for locating leaks in historic pipe materials like lead and galvanised steel. This allows us to pinpoint the source accurately with minimal disruption, saving crucial time and limiting damage to your home's fabric.
